Foundationally Yours:
How to Make Funders Fall in Love with Your Mission 

Ready to move beyond one-off grants? This session will show you how to transform existing funder relationships into long-term partnerships that provide stability, flexibility, and growth. Learn the practical steps nonprofits can take to build trust, demonstrate impact, and position themselves for multi-year, unrestricted funding that supports lasting mission success.

What You’ll Learn:

Participants will walk away with practical strategies they can apply immediately to strengthen funder relationships and build sustainable funding.

  • How to move from one-time grants to long-term funding partnerships
    Understand the shift from transactional grant seeking to relationship-based funding.
  • Why foundations are increasingly offering multi-year and unrestricted funding
    Learn the trends shaping modern philanthropy and what they mean for your organization.
  • How to identify the right foundations to focus on
    Discover how alignment, geography, and giving history can guide smarter outreach.
  • The key signals that indicate a funder may become a long-term partner
    Recognize the signs that a relationship has growth potential.
  • Practical ways to build trust with foundations over time
    Learn simple, consistent touchpoints that strengthen relationships and credibility.
  • How to position your organization to “act big” — regardless of size
    Understand the importance of professionalism, readiness, and strong organizational optics.
  • What funders look for before committing to ongoing support
    Explore the role of governance, stewardship, leadership, and demonstrated impact.
  • How to nurture existing funder relationships for repeat and expanded funding
    Learn how thoughtful communication and follow-up can lead to deeper partnerships.
  • Strategies for discovering new funder relationships through existing networks
    See how connections, introductions, and referrals can open new doors.
  • The long-term mindset required to secure sustainable funding
    Learn how prioritizing relationship-building today creates stability for the future.
